Janke et al identified factors impacting the life satisfaction for patients with inflammatory bowel disease (Crohn's disease and ulcerative colitis). These can help identify patients who may benefit from interventions to improve the quality of their lives. The authors are from University Hospital Tubingen in Germany.


 

Life satisfaction was reported as general (GLS) or health-related (HRLS).

 

Factors affecting life satisfaction for a patient with Crohn's disease:

(1) psychiatric disorder (highest odds ratio)

(2) medical comorbidity

(3) disease activity

(4) level of social support

 

Factors affecting life satisfaction for a patient with ulcerative colitis (UC):

(1) psychiatric disorder

(2) disease activity

(3) level of social support
